One of my favourite brands which was showcasing was @Road140. They had a pretty cool 90's vibe with many things I like and can associate with and made them into their own by adding their London fingerprint to each piece. 


'Grime' Theft Auto. 'G.a.n.g.G.a.n.g' in the place of 'F.r.i.e.n.d.s'. Wheres 'Wiley' in place of 'Wally'. Such an awesome take on childhood memories and an excellent play on words.


I especially loved their Nike Air trainers with the names of London rappers in place of tube station names.Apparently Giggs has promoted these and they've had a lot of interest. I'm not a fan of the trainers per say however I do love the concept which I believe they've made into a t-shirt as well.
